Registered Washington Agent Summary

The role of a registered Washington agent is crucial for services and organizations running within the state, making sure conformity with regional policies and lawful needs. This agent functions as the main point of call in between the state federal government and the entity, obtaining legal records, notifications, and service of process in support of the firm. Maintaining a registered agent in Washington is a lawful obligation for LLCs, firms, and other entities, giving a dependable address for solution of process and official correspondence. The agent's duties include forwarding essential lawful records without delay to the business, which helps in staying clear of fines and lawful issues. Several organizations choose expert registered representative services to guarantee compliance and to safeguard their personal privacy, especially if they do not have a physical existence in Washington.
